Amazon’s robot-driven warehouses could cut fulfillment costs by $10 billion a year

Isaac Hammouch1 year ago02 mins

In brief: Amazon has spent years investing in robots that work in its fulfillment centers around the world. Developing and deploying these machines costs millions of dollars, but a new report claims they could save the tech giant up to $10 billion a year by 2030.
